Nitrogen bulletin posted on CSB site

Nov 28, 2005 12:27 PM

The Chemical and Safety Investigation Hazard Board (CSB) has posted on its Web site its 2003 safety bulletin on nitrogen highlights and good safety practices.

The safety bulletin is published to bring additional attention to the continuing hazards of nitrogen asphyxiation.

In the decade between 1992 and 2002, 130 workplace fatalities and injuries occurred from breathing nitrogen-enriched air. Over 60 percent of these victims were working in or next to a confined space, CSB reported.
